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Newbies Guide to Metal Polishing - Most frequently, the finishing of metal is desirable for aesthetic reasons as well as clean-room applications. It's one of the most popular processes for its utility in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the product, as an example, motor bike parts, kitchenware or automobile parts. Also, a lot of clean-rooms would need a burnished finish in order to reduce the penetrability of the material which could result in debris to gather and contaminate. A good example of this use could be in a vacuum chamber. You'll find quite a few means to finish metals, and below I will examine a little about examples of the techniques involved. Metal may be burnished by hand, using specialized buffing machines, electromechanically or by means of chemicals. A particular finishing compound or paste is commonly utilised, that may include chromium oxide, tripoli,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, limestone,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its mediocre thermal conductivity, reasonably high viscidity, and hardness is considered the most time-consuming. On the contrary, items made out of non-ferrous metal are definitely more amenable to buffing, since these require the lower amount of operations.
When a superior processing quality is not necessary, higher pad speeds should be employed. A reduced pad speed is utilized any time a high standard mirror finish is crucial. Polishing buffs covered in compound are seriously affected by specific forces on the pad. The level of the pressure on the surface can be increased to a specific scope, however implementing in excess of the maximum degree of force not only cuts down on the quality level of the process, but additionally lessens the level of performance, can create wear on the component, and there's furthermore an apparent heating up of the items being worked on, due to friction. When polishing thinner material, it will be raised heat (and the ensuing bendability of the metal) that cause components to twist, distort, or bend. Generally, it will require a professional polisher to look at all these variables to both avoid damage to the part and to work efficiently. To help substantially improve the quality of the completed surface area, the polishing procedure must really be executed with significantly less aggression and not as much pressure to be able to in due course complete a surface with no scores or fine lines as a consequence of the finishing process, thus arriving at a lovely mirror finish.
